A Work From Home Policy is an agreement between employer and employee that clearly defines the expectations and responsibilities for employees who work from home. You may set eligibility criteria – i.e., only those employees who have been at the company for 90 days and hit 90% of their goals can work remotely. Confirm that all employees have the necessary security or encryption software loaded onto their devices, regularly remind them of their data protection requirements, and encourage them to stay vigilant to protect against security threats.
